Audit item 14 — barcode scanner integration (Cartwheel POS). Check that the Zephyrscan driver bridge validates symbology before passing payloads to checkout, and that malformed scans get logged, not silently dropped. Also eyeball the retry loop — last quarter it hammered the device on disconnect. If anything looks off, don't just flag it in the review; this one needs a human on the hook. Accountability for this item sits with the engineer named below.

named custodian: Belius Casath Ulaix Sorius

Subject: Shared lab arrangements with the Larkfell team

Hello Facilities,

As agreed at last week's review, our analysts at Corvella Systems will share Lab 2.1 with the Larkfell Instruments team from Monday. Please note the lab has two entrances; only the north door should be used, as the south door alarms after hours. Equipment on the left bench belongs to Larkfell and must not be moved. Cleaning access remains unchanged. For the shared north door, the entry code is as follows.

staff pass of kawip-hawef = bdg-QLP-2

## Build provenance: per-tenant rate quotas

Hey plugin folks — every quota change in Gatewisp is now tied to a signed build. If your plugin starts getting throttled unexpectedly, don't guess: pull the provenance record and see which quota config shipped with that build. The Lanternfold registry keeps ninety days of history, so you can diff tenant limits between any two releases. When filing a support ticket, always quote the token, which for the current build appears below.

session token of yajof-bagef = htk4_937d

Hey Marisol — handing off the Quillbarn report builder sort fix. We swapped to a stable merge sort so tied rows keep insertion order; the security angle is that the audit export now matches the on-screen view exactly. Tests pass on staging. To unlock the signing vault for the release build, use the passphrase below.

unlock words, kawig-bawef: belax-sorir-druax-ulaiel-wenael-belael